diff --git a/ios/Video/RCTVideo.swift b/ios/Video/RCTVideo.swift index 70ae6e81..1f05c898 100644 --- a/ios/Video/RCTVideo.swift +++ b/ios/Video/RCTVideo.swift @@ -199,8 +199,11 @@ class RCTVideo: UIView, RCTVideoPlayerViewControllerDelegate, RCTPlayerObserverH deinit { NotificationCenter.default.removeObserver(self) self.removePlayerLayer() - _pip = nil _playerObserver.clearPlayer() + + #if os(iOS) + _pip = nil + #endif } // MARK: - App lifecycle handlers